Banana-Strawberry Cheesecake Fantasy Recipe

  • Total Time: 1 hour 40 minutes
  • Yield: 12 1x

Ingredients

Scale

Fruits:

  • 3 ripe bananas, mashed
  • 1 ½ cups chopped strawberries

Dairy and Cheese:

  • 4 (8 ounces/226 grams) packages c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ted

Base and Binding Ingredients:

  • 2 cups graham cracker crumbs
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 ½ cups granulated sugar
  • ¼ cup all-purpose flour
  • 3 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Warm the oven to 325°F (160°C) and generously coat a 9-inch springform pan with cooking spray to ensure seamless cake removal.
  2. Combine graham cracker crumbs with melted butter, creating a uniform mixture that will form the foundation of the dessert.
  3. Press the crumb mixture firmly and evenly into the pan’s bottom, creating a compact and sturdy base.
  4. Mash ripe bananas and blend with lemon juice, which helps preserve their golden color and prevents oxidation.
  5. In a spacious mixing bowl, whip cream cheese and sugar until achieving a silky, lump-free consistency.
  6. Integrate eggs individually, thoroughly blending each before adding the next to maintain a smooth texture.
  7. Incorporate sour cream, vanilla extract, and flour, stirring until the mixture reaches a velvety, uniform appearance.
  8. Delicately fold the banana mixture and chopped strawberries into the batter, ensuring an even distribution of fruity elements.
  9. Transfer the filling into the prepared crust, using a spatula to create an impeccably level surface.
  10. Bake for 60-70 minutes, monitoring until the center remains slightly wobbly but mostly set.
  11. Extinguish the oven’s heat, allowing the cheesecake to rest inside with the door closed for an additional hour, which helps prevent surface cracking.
  12. Remove the cheesecake and let it cool completely on a wire rack, allowing residual heat to dissipate gradually.
  13. Refrigerate for a minimum of 4 hours, preferably overnight, to enhance flavor melding and achieve optimal texture.

Notes

  • Chill the cheesecake overnight to develop rich, complex flavor profiles that marry banana and strawberry essences perfectly.
  • Ensure cream cheese is room temperature before mixing to create silky-smooth, lump-free filling with luxurious texture.
  • Use fresh, ripe bananas and strawberries for maximum natural sweetness and vibrant color in this decadent dessert.
